問題タブ [popupwindow]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
4043 参照

wpf - マウスがlistBoxアイテムの上にあるときに「ポップアップウィンドウ」を表示する

listBox に監視可能なコレクションをバインドします。リストボックス項目にデータ テンプレートがあります。1 つのイメージ コントロールといくつかの textBlock で構成されます。

いくつかの listBox アイテムの上にマウスがある場合、この動作を実現したいと思います:

  • PopUp/ToolTip (コントロールのある「四角形」) を表示し、listBox の現在の項目から値をバインドします。
  • そして、私がスタイルを持っているアイテムデータテンプレートのテキストボックスで、テキストブロックのテキストの色を、たとえば黒から緑に変更したいと思います。

スタイルはこちら:

私の英語で申し訳ありませんが、この動作を正しく説明する方法に問題があります。いろいろやってみるがどれもうまくいかない。

これが私のスタイルです:

私を助けてくれたみんなに感謝します。

0 投票する
1 に答える
1890 参照

android - Android モードレス ポップアップウィンドウ

Android でモードレスの popupwindow を作成できないようです。popupwindow を問題なく作成でき、イベントを受け取ります。ただし、必要なのはイベントを受け取ることです。ユーザーがポップアップ ウィンドウの外側をクリックすると、アクティビティは通常どおりイベントを受け取ります。

私は実際にはダイアログを使用したくありません。コントロールがポップアップする外観を探しています。ユーザーはそれをクリックするか、アクティビティ内の他のものをクリックすることを選択できます。

私はFLAG_NOT_TOUCH_MODALについて読んできましたが、ポップアップウィンドウでこれをうまく機能させることができないようです。

何か案は?

0 投票する
1 に答える
2051 参照

android - PopupWindow内のAndroidボタン

アプリケーションに、一種の設定ウィンドウとして機能するポップアップウィンドウがあります。この中には、チェックボックスなどの小さなビューがいくつかありますが、正しく機能させるのに問題があるようです。

現在、ビューにボタンが1つしかないので、それを使用してポップアップウィンドウを閉じようとしていますが、onClickListenerを設定しようとするとNullPointerExceptionが発生します。実際、「button.isShown()」のようなものであっても、ボタンを参照すると、ボタンが存在しないかのように例外が発生します。

私は考えられるすべてのことを試しましたが、この問題を完全に解決するものはありません。PopupWindow内にボタンを機能させる方法があると思いますか、それとも、目的の効果を得るために何らかの形式のダイアログを変更する必要がありますか?

ご協力ありがとうございました。

0 投票する
1 に答える
550 参照

popupwindow - ポップアップウィンドウをアクティブにする

このようなコードがいくつかあり、ポップアップウィンドウを開こうとしていて、それをアクティブにしてソースに機能を持たせたくない

どんな助けでも大歓迎です。

0 投票する
0 に答える
3867 参照

jsf - H:CommandLink actionListener コードは、jsf コンポーネントがクリックされると再び起動します

を含む JSP ページがありh:dataTableます。h:commandLinkデータテーブルには、新しいポップアップ ウィンドウを開くコンポーネントの列があります。これらの commandLink コンポーネントactionListenerには、ページのバッキング Bean にメソッドがあります。このコードは、クリックされた commandLink コンポーネントを特定し、そのパラメーターを取得して、サーブレットにリダイレクトします。サーブレットはファイルをポップアップ ウィンドウに書き込み、[名前を付けて保存/開く] ダイアログ ボックスを表示して、ユーザーが書き込まれたファイルをダウンロードできるようにします。これはすべてうまくいきます。

ただし、ポップアップ ウィンドウを閉じた後、ページの JSF ボタンをクリックすると、[名前を付けて保存/開く] ダイアログ ボックスが再び表示されます。このダイアログ ボックスが再度表示されないようにするにはどうすればよいですか? Page1.jspJSFボタンがクリックされる前に更新された場合、これは起こらないことに気付きました。

コードは次のとおりです。

Page1.jsp

Page1バッキングビーン

processRequest メソッドによって呼び出されるサーブレット コード:

0 投票する
4 に答える
78398 参照

javascript - ポップアップ ウィンドウを閉じて親ウィンドウをリダイレクトする方法

このコードをポップアップ許可ダイアログに使用します。ユーザーがクリックすると、ポップアップでFacebookがユーザーを私のアプリにリダイレクトできるようになります。ポップアップウィンドウから親ウィンドウにコードを送信し、ユーザーが許可をクリックしたときにポップアップを閉じる必要があります。

0 投票する
5 に答える
18683 参照

javascript - クリックしたときに画像を新しいウィンドウに印刷する最も簡単な方法は何ですか?

クリックして画像を印刷するための簡単なリンクを作成しようとしています。リンクをクリックすると、新しいウィンドウが画像とともに開き、ブラウザーが印刷コマンド ダイアログ ボックスを開きます。

私の質問は、これが URL パラメーターからのみ可能か、それとも開始ページのアンカー要素から可能かということです。または、これを行うには、javascript を使用してターゲット ページを作成する必要がありますか?

これが私が持っているもののサンプルです:

明らかに、上記のコードは新しいウィンドウで画像を開きますが、それでもユーザーは Ctrl+P、Cmd+P を押すか、ブラウザー コマンドを使用する必要があります。私のクライアントは、ユーザーがリンクをクリックしたときに画像を「印刷するだけ」にしたいので、これを実現する最も簡単な方法を見つけようとしています。

私が説明したことを達成するために、上記のマークアップに追加できるパラメーターまたは属性はありますか?

0 投票する
5 に答える
5025 参照

windows - MATLAB: Figure がアクティブにならないようにする

数時間実行できるかなり大きなルーチンがあります。あちこちで Figure を作成し、それに何かをプロットして、その Figure を保存します。

PCが一台しかないので、そのマシンで仕事を続けたいと思っています。問題は、新しい Figure が作成されるたびに、MATLAB が再びアクティブなアプリケーションになることです。MATLAB または Windows に、MATLAB が自身をアクティブに設定することを許可しないように指示する方法はありますか?

MATLAB スクリプトを完全にバックグラウンドで実行することが 1 つの可能性であることがわかりました (そのように)。しかし、MATLAB ウィンドウに切り替えて、コマンド ウィンドウへの出力を確認できるようにしたいので、これは少し監視されていません。

何か案は?他のアプリケーションがアクティブになるのを防ぐ Windows 用の一般的な解決策があれば、それもクールです!

0 投票する
2 に答える
10388 参照

css - JavaScriptを使用せずにポップアップウィンドウを画面の中央に配置する

HTMLとCSSをフォローしていますが、ポップアップウィンドウを任意のブラウザウィンドウサイズの画面の中央に配置したいと思います。これはJavaScriptなしで可能ですか?

CSS:

HTML:

0 投票する
4 に答える
4744 参照

android - Androidのスピナーのポップアップメニュー

アイテム「A」、「B」、「C」のスピナーが欲しい

「A」または「B」を選択すると、クロノメーターを実行する必要があります。

アイテム「C」を選択している間、ポップアップウィンドウには、編集テキストと「OK」ボタンが2つ開いています..

編集テキストに「D」と入力すると、スピナーを追加し、コノメーターを実行する必要があることを意味します

ここに私のコードがあります:

私に何か助けてもらえますか